Kenton-on-Sea, more commonly known as Kenton, is a small coastal town on the
Sunshine Coast, in the Eastern Cape of South Africa. It is situated between the
Bushman's River and the Kariega River, and lies approximately half way between
the industrial centres of East London (180km) and Port Elizabeth (130km).
Kenton-on-Sea is one of the most beautiful places in the country - the Kariega
beach was voted the best beach in South Africa just 6 years ago. Kenton has a
population of only about 1000 people, but is a popular holiday resort, and the
population triples over the period of the December Summer holidays. The area
has many pristine beaches and green rolling hills, and a nature reserve along
the shore ensures that no housing developments can spoil the coast.
The mouths of the Boesmans and Kariega rivers and both tidal waterways offer
great fishing and bird-watching opportunities. There are rolling sand dunes,
fantastic rock pools and rock formations to delight both adult and child alike.
The two rivers are navigable and sightings of the fish eagle and little sunbird
are frequent.
Kenton-on-Sea is a great destination for nature lovers as well as adventure
seekers as it is only a few kilometres from a number of game reserves that
offer malaria free game viewing, including the Big Five. Aside from a plethora
of water sports, Kenton-on-Sea offers hiking trails, mountain biking, township
tours and is close enough to Grahamstown to afford easy access to the annual
National Arts Festival.
Unusually for a small town in South Africa, Kenton is predominantly
English-speaking, while Boesmansriviermond on the opposite banks of the
Bushman's River, is predominantly Afrikaans-speaking. Being in the Eastern
Cape, the townships and surrounding areas are Xhosa-speaking.
